Shou Sugi Ban in interiors is often described as a simple technique for creating black, highly textured wood. The reality is more precise: the correct Japanese term is yakisugi, a traditional process involving the surface charring of sugi boards, Cryptomeria japonica, historically used as cladding in the vernacular architecture of western Japan. Indoors, this surface can become a wall, ceiling, door, panel or furniture detail, but it requires specific decisions regarding brushing, finishing and soot stabilisation. Above all, it should not be described as automatically fireproof, waterproof or indestructible: performance depends on wood species, depth of charring, final coating, installation and the specific certified product.
Shou Sugi Ban or yakisugi: which is the correct term?

In Japan, the material is known as yakisugi, from yaki, meaning burnt or charred, and sugi, the wood of Cryptomeria japonica. The term may also appear as yakisugi-ita, meaning yakisugi board. “Shou Sugi Ban”, now widely used in Europe and North America, is instead a Westernised reading that became popular outside Japan and is not the traditional term used in the country. Nakamoto Forestry traces it to an improper combination of Japanese and Chinese readings of the characters.
The distinction is not merely linguistic.
Historic yakisugi is associated with thin charred sugi boards used as cladding, a practice documented for centuries, particularly in western Japan and around the Seto Inland Sea. Calling every oak, spruce or pine board blackened with a torch “Shou Sugi Ban” therefore greatly expands the original meaning.
In contemporary interior design, the expression is now useful and widely recognised, but it is more accurate to distinguish between traditional yakisugi and more generic charred woods or charred timber inspired by the same principle.
How the charred surface is created
In the traditional process, three boards are joined together to form a triangular chimney-like structure. A fire is lit inside, and the resulting draught encourages rapid charring of the surfaces facing the flame.
Experimental research into the traditional technique recreated this process using spruce and fir boards: within a few minutes, surface temperatures exceeded 500 °C and a charred layer several millimetres thick formed. The study also shows how strongly the result depends on wood species, temperature, duration and the position of the board during treatment.
Today, industrial methods also use burners, kilns, heated plates and more controlled processes. These can produce more uniform surfaces and, in some cases, less fragile finishes than traditional charring. They are not necessarily inferior; they simply belong to a different production method.
For an interior project, the useful question is therefore not simply “has it been burnt?”, but how it was charred, which species was used and what treatment was applied afterwards.
From deep black char to brushed grain: texture can vary dramatically
Charred wood does not have a single appearance.
A surface left with its char layer almost intact can develop a black, irregular and fragile texture, often resembling reptile scales. Grazing light emphasises cracks, flakes and differences in depth.
When the most friable layer is instead brushed, the grain of the timber becomes visible again and the black can give way to browns, greys and contrasts between charred wood and lighter fibres.
Within its own production, Nakamoto Forestry distinguishes between surfaces where the char is retained, versions brushed once and variants brushed further to reveal more of the grain. This classification belongs to a specific manufacturer, but it illustrates the principle clearly: the amount of char removed largely determines the final appearance.
Indoors, this distinction is crucial. The more char and soot the surface retains, the greater the need to control contact and finishing.
Shou Sugi Ban in interiors: where it works best
The simplest way to use the material is as vertical wall cladding, particularly on a selected surface.
A black wall behind a sofa, a screen in a corridor or the backdrop to a dining area can introduce depth without turning the entire home into a dark interior. Char reacts to light differently from ordinary black paint: it absorbs a great deal of light, but irregularities in the grain generate close shadows and subtle reflections.
In A House of Small Talks by WARP Architects, a large freestanding charred timber wall becomes the backdrop around which the living area and staircase are organised. The contrast with concrete, natural timber, white walls and planting allows the dark material to work as an orienting element rather than an isolated decorative surface.
In commercial spaces, the effect can be taken much further. At Leña Marbella by Astet Studio, references to fire and charring extend across walls, ceilings and furniture to create an almost entirely black interior. It is coherent with the restaurant concept, but far more difficult to transfer literally into a home.
Walls, doors and furniture require different treatments

A wall positioned away from circulation can tolerate a highly tactile texture. A door, cabinet front or piece of furniture that is touched constantly requires a more stable surface.
For interior applications, Nakamoto Forestry generally recommends finishes capable of binding any residual soot to the surface; it also offers products with unbrushed char protected by specific coatings and brushed versions with finishes suitable for interior panelling.
This point is often overlooked in the most dramatic photographs.
A completely raw finish can mark hands, fabrics and adjacent surfaces if it retains unstabilised particles. The same manufacturer recommends removing any residual material with appropriate cleaning after installation and, for many indoor applications, using a treatment that stabilises the surface.
For wall panelling behind a bed or a high wall, a more pronounced texture may therefore be appropriate; for cabinet fronts, integrated handles, doors and low furniture, specifying a brushed or protected surface is generally more practical.
Does the wood have to be black to be authentic?
Not necessarily.
The most recognisable image of yakisugi is deep black char, but brushing, oxidation and oils can change the colour substantially. Some surfaces become dark brown, grey or streaked, revealing more of the underlying grain.
Time also changes the material, particularly outdoors. Indoors, evolution is slower because rain and continuous direct exposure to sunlight are absent, but finishes, cleaning and abrasion still form part of the life of the surface.
Wood simply darkened with pigment, stain or paint can reproduce the colour without having a carbonised surface. It is not a “fake” solution if described correctly: it is simply burnt-effect stained timber, technically different from yakisugi.
Which wood species are used?

The traditional technique is associated with sugi, Cryptomeria japonica, a conifer native to Japan. The Nara National Museum describes sugi as a lightweight, relatively soft, straight-grained wood historically used for numerous wooden objects and structures.
The international spread of Shou Sugi Ban has, however, led to many other species being charred.
Experimental studies have examined spruce and fir, while contemporary architecture also includes examples using pine, larch, cypress and other local timbers.
They do not all respond in the same way. Density, resin content, grain orientation and wood anatomy influence charring rate, cracking, dimensional stability and absorption.
For this reason, a European charred spruce panel may produce an excellent design result, but it should not automatically be presented as traditional Japanese yakisugi.
Fire resistance: why “burnt” does not mean fireproof
This is perhaps the most important myth to correct.
The presence of a charred layer can alter the way wood behaves when exposed to heat, but it does not automatically make a board fire-resistant or compliant with a specific reaction-to-fire classification.
A study by the USDA Forest Products Laboratory compared several commercially charred products with untreated wood. The results did not show a consistent improvement in ignition resistance or fire performance: some samples improved, while others did not. The authors concluded that charring should not be considered a universal guarantee of better fire behaviour.
More recent research indicates that the thickness and uniformity of the char layer can materially affect performance, but for exactly this reason, superficial decorative charring is not equivalent to an engineered fire-resistant system.
In interiors, particularly hospitality, retail and public spaces, the required product classification and complete build-up must therefore be verified against the applicable regulations.
Nor is charred wood automatically waterproof
Charring can reduce surface wettability and water absorption under certain conditions.
Studies on spruce have found greater hydrophobicity in charred surfaces and reduced water and vapour absorption. Other experiments, however, have produced different results depending on species and treatment conditions. The charred layer also remains porous and can contain cracks through which water can reach the timber underneath.
Describing it as “waterproof” is therefore an overstatement.
In dry interiors, the issue is generally limited. In bathrooms, near basins or in other areas exposed to splashing, substrate, finish, joints and the manufacturer’s instructions need to be assessed, just as they would for any other timber cladding.
How to combine it without turning the home into a Japanese-themed interior
Charred timber does not require tatami, lanterns or other decorative references to Japan.
In fact, the most convincing combinations often treat yakisugi simply as a dark, textured material.
Paired with pale oak, ash or birch, it creates a clear contrast between two expressions of the same material. Combined with concrete and steel, it shifts the interior towards a more mineral palette. With travertine, lime finishes and rough textiles, it softens the industrial quality of the black surface.
At A Window to Korea Store by Canter & Gallop Design, a charred timber wall is combined with stainless steel, metallic surfaces and textured panels, focusing particularly on the transition between light and dark areas.
The Ronin Bar by studio…nutto, meanwhile, combines yakisugi with granite, concrete, metal and corrugated glass; inside, an almost entirely black palette allows planting and lighting to stand out most strongly.
In a home, far fewer elements are often enough: a dark wall and a light floor can already create the necessary contrast.
Light is part of the texture
A charred wall changes dramatically depending on how it is lit.
Frontal lighting tends to flatten the black surface, while a side light reveals grain, cracks and differences in depth. A highly textured surface can therefore become almost three-dimensional under grazing light.
This makes Shou Sugi Ban interesting even on relatively small surfaces: a niche, the back of a bookcase or a wall behind a lamp may be enough.
The opposite effect should also be considered. Large quantities of very dark timber visually absorb light and can make an already dim room feel heavier. In this case, pale surfaces, windows, bright ceilings and indirect lighting need to rebalance the composition.
How to clean and maintain charred wood indoors
Maintenance depends mainly on the finish.
On stabilised or coated surfaces, the coating manufacturer’s instructions should be followed. On brushed, uncoated timber, aggressive abrasion should be avoided because it can selectively alter the texture.
One of the main considerations remains residual soot. For interior use, Nakamoto Forestry recommends a final clean with a clean cloth or sponge and, for many applications, finishes that bind residual particles to the surface.
There is therefore no universal maintenance routine for “burnt wood”. A charred surface left almost intact and a brushed wall protected with an acrylic coating may feel similar to the touch but behave very differently in practical use.
Authentic yakisugi or simply a burnt-wood effect: which should you choose?
The choice depends on the aim of the project.
If the priority is the historic technique, its relationship with sugi and the specific charred structure, it makes sense to look for yakisugi produced through documented processes and to verify its origin, wood species and treatment.
If the main interest is instead the visual language — very dark timber, pronounced grain and an irregular surface — a charred local species, an industrial panel or even stained timber may be more appropriate alternatives for the budget and application.
The problem arises when different materials are presented as though they were equivalent.
Shou Sugi Ban in interiors becomes most interesting when it loses the exotic aura with which it is often presented. Yakisugi originated as a practical building material, not as ritual decoration. Brought indoors, it can become a tactile wall, a piece of furniture, a door or a simple black detail, but it should retain the same precision: wood species, charring, finish, contact, lighting and safety requirements should all be verified before the aesthetic effect.
Perhaps this is the most contemporary aspect of the technique: fire is not used to turn timber into a miraculous material. It is used to transform the surface, leaving process, irregularity and materiality visible.
